Estimate research on co-carbonization of blend coal with waste plastics

The 50 g co-carbonization test of blend coals with two high-volatile bituminous coals and two low-volatile bituminous coals and added waste plastics(PE, PP, PS and PET) under 1.33 kPa was investigated at a plastic addition ratio of 2%~10%. Co-carbonization was performed from 200℃, at a heating ratio of 3 K/min, to 900℃. In the study of coke strength, coke reactivity index and porosity, we appended the anthracite of different addition ratios of 0%, 5%, and 10%. The result shows that 1) In the case of anthracite addition ratio of 5%, the effect of PE and PP on blend coals is similar and the coke strength reaches the maximum at the plastic addition ratio of 6% and then decreases; 2) PS and PET deteriorate the coke strength, observably at the addition ratio of 5%; and 3) both the coke reactivity and porosity increase with the increase of addition ratio of waste plastics. This study shows that mirco strength of coke with 5% anthracite addition can effectively distinguish the effect of different addition ratio and types of waste plastics on coke property.
